If you're shopping for a new sofa made of leather, it's important to understand the difference between different types of leather. There are four main types: top-grain, top-grain distressed semi-aniline and aniline. Top-grain is the cheapest leather and has a uniform appearance. It's less likely to stain than other types of leather, however, it can still be scratched or scuffed. Top-grain distressed is treated to make it impervious to stains and scratches. It's a great choice for areas with a lot of traffic.

Semi-aniline leather is coated with a protective layer that makes it resistant to water, stains and oil. It is not as stain-resistant as full-aniline, but it is still a good choice for messy homes. Full-aniline leather doesn't have a protective layer, and will develop a natural patina when exposed to body oils and wear. This type of leather is breathable and will soften and more comfortable with time.
